<p>Department:</p> <p>PMG Parrish Medical Group</p> <p>Location:</p> <p>Titus Landing</p> <p>Schedule:</p> <p>Full Time; 8:00a - 5:00p</p> <p>General Description:</p> <p>The Certified Professional Midwife is responsible for promoting and demonstrating Parrish Healthcare's Culture of Choice ; and is an Allied Health Professional member of Parrish Medical Center's Medical Staff. The Certified Professional Midwife is responsible for ensuring strategic goals and objectives are met or exceeded by providing leadership, direction, and oversight to effectively fulfill our mission to provide Healing Experiences for Everyone all the Time and achieve organizational strategic (Game Plan) goals.</p> <p>Key Responsibilities:</p> <ul> <li>Monitoring the health of pregnant women and their unborn babies. Support physiology and promote normal birth. </li><li>Educating patients as well as their partners and family members on reproductive health, preparation for parenthood, and antenatal care. Uphold human rights and informed consent and decision making for women. </li><li>Confirming and dating pregnancy. Providing prenatal and postpartum care. Caring for women during childbirth including monitoring the mother and fetus during labor, assessing labor progress, managing complications, assisting with pain management, performing episiotomies if needed, and delivering the newborn and placenta. </li><li>Promote evidence-based practice, including reducing unnecessary interventions. </li><li>Teach patients pain management techniques to prepare them for labor. </li><li>Delivering patients' babies in birthing centers, patients' homes, or hospitals as well as providing emotional support and encouragement during labor. </li><li>Taking and recording patients' blood pressure, temperature, and pulse as well as ordering diagnostic tests as needed. </li><li>Monitor maternal and neonatal outcomes, report quality indicators and participate in performance improvement initiatives. </li><li>Will respond to and partake in activating emergency protocols and coordinate transfers to high-level of care when necessary. </li><li>Help with community outreach, patient education programs and participating in prenatal classes. </li><li>Be competent and proficient in Electronic Medical Records (EHRs) and telehealth platforms. </li><li>Assess, diagnose, act, intervene, consult and refer as necessary, including providing emergency interventions. </li><li>Helping patients and their partners to cope with miscarriages, stillbirths, neonatal deaths, and terminations. </li><li>Teaching new mothers how to feed their newborns. </li><li>Providing sound advice to patients regarding diets, exercises, and medications suitable for pregnancy. </li><li>Required to maintain certification, licensure and keep up to date on continuing education. </li><li>Will partake in the call rotation as first of call, backup support provided by physicians. </li><li>Follow rules and regulations within the collaborative agreements with physicians, to include compliance and regulations in Midwifery for the State of Florida, </li><li>Be sensitive to culturally diverse population in the healthcare system. </li><li>Performs other duties as assigned. </li><li>Knows fire, disaster and safety procedures and regulations as it pertains to the work area. </li></ul> <p>Requirements:</p> <p>Formal Education:</p> <ul> <li>Bachelor's Degree in midwifery required. Masters (MSN) or Doctorate in Nursing (DNP) preferred. </li></ul> <p>Work Experience:</p> <ul> <li>Two or more years of clinical experience as a certified professional midwife at a physician practice or in a hospital with a related specialty is strongly preferred. </li></ul> <p>Required Licenses, Certifications, Registrations:</p> <ul> <li>Certified by either the American Midwifery Certification Board (AMCB) or North American Registry of Midwives (NARM). </li><li>Appropriate state licensure required. </li><li>Basic Life Support (BLS) through The American Heart Association required. </li><li>Neonatal Resuscitation Program (NRP) certification required. </li></ul> <p>Why Work for Parrish?
